Machining & CNC Apprenticeships in Georgia

20 registered apprenticeship sponsors in Georgia train machining & cnc apprentices. Registered apprenticeships (U.S. Dept of Labor) pay wages from day one — training costs are typically covered by the sponsor instead of tuition. Yes — Registered Apprenticeship Programs coordinated through Apprentice Georgia (Technical College System of Georgia / WorkSource Georgia); CNC Machinist apprentices work full-time while completing ~600 hours of technical-college instruction.
